Hello All,

We have a requirement where we have to  display special characters such as ü, ö, ä and ß.

I found one SAP Note : 1343744 - Special characters in team calendar



It states to install relevent fonts on the IGS server. can someone help how we can do it?

Hi Mohit,

Update fonts on IGS server and take a restart to rebuilt the page correctly.

Also, if in your case, the page is building at the client side, then you need to install the fonts on the frontend machine.
